RFID enables efficiency in Chestnut Hill PA’s recycling process

Chestnut Hill, PA uses RFID technology integrated into the town’s recycling process, managed under the RecycleBank rewards program.  The RFID tag identifies the recycling container as the truck collects the material and the homeowner accumulates points that can be redeemed.  This is a good program for increasing the amount of the homeowner waste stream that is recycled.  …

…   “The new program will use an RFID radio frequency ID sticker, an advance in technology beyond the device used in the initial pilot program. Once participants receive the sticker, it can be attached to the recycling container … “   …
